Plate 8.7 Vulnerability of Groundwater Ressources

The term «vulnerability» refers to the sensitivity of a system in relation to a harmful external influence. In the case of groundwater, vulnerability is defined as the exposure to pollution through the influx of harmful substances into the aquifer. This plate shows the vulnerability of groundwater resources to potential pollutants throughout Switzerland.
